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00964819555 31211026789 76950 80
740 88246351 232271
740 88246351 232271
50737133 2678765 3134097 8743 43336135
All about undefined
Interested in learning more?
740 88246351 232271
50737133 2678765 3134097 8743 43336135
See more
24828131 243380142 03415614964
507 05601 5994611934
See more
5562565563 1797 24703313
9079 2727 86627383872
See more